Hi Sam, what was your thought process behind starting your own business?
I was working in a completely different industry and just wasn’t happy anymore. It was a good job, but I didn’t have the passion and drive I used to have and eventually came to a point where I asked myself the question: is this where I want to be in 20 years?
At the same time, I have always been doing photography on the side and loved it. It has always been a dream of mine to earn my living doing photography, being creative. The photography that I have been doing on the side has been growing so much in the past years that I reached the point where I could realistically consider it an option.
So I made the jump, because I don’t want to look back in 20 years and ask myself “What if…”.


Let’s talk shop? Tell us more about your career, what can you share with our community?
I think what makes my work stand out is the creative use of Photoshop. While I am mainly a product photographer, I use photoshop to create fictional worlds or help create a scenario that would not be possible with “traditional“ photography.
I’ve always been a very visual and imaginative person and I have discovered fairly early that Photoshop is an incredible tool to help me visualize the images that I had in my head. I have been using Photoshop to create concept art and matte paintings even before I even owned a camera, so naturally when I did get involved with photography, I let my background bleed into my work.
I wasn’t sure how people would react to it, because it’s not what you’d typically see from a “photographer“, and I have been called out for calling myself a photographer while 70% of an image was created digitally from scratch. But all that was telling me was that I am doing something different, something that maybe hasn’t been seen before in my niche of the industry at that time. So, it only encouraged me to keep going.
That is pretty much in line with all the decisions I have made in my life: if you’re passionate about something and you love it with all your heart, double down and give it your all.
